Methodology

How we calculated this

The first name Jiri has a living-bearer frequency of 0.0000% of the US population, based on 16 estimated living Americans carrying this first name (from SSA birth records going back to 1880, adjusted for mortality using CDC life tables).

Even though the Census Bureau now publishes first-name tables, we do not use that file as the main first-name input for this estimate. The latest first-name Census snapshot is from 2020, which makes it 6 years old today. Because Census first-name data is only released once every 10 years, SSA birth records plus CDC survival rates give a better current estimate of how many people are likely alive with the name Jiri right now.

The surname Fischer appears at a rate of 23.59 per 100,000 residents in the 2020 Census Bureau surname file, which translates to a frequency of 0.0236%.

Multiplying these two independent frequencies against the current US population of 342,754,338 gives an expected count of approximately 1 people with the full name Jiri Fischer. This assumes statistical independence between first and last names, which is a simplification but produces reasonable estimates for most combinations.
